About
Comprehensive Healthcare is a private nonprofit behavioral health provider based in Yakima, Washington. Established in 1973, it operates as a large community mental health center serving children, adults, and families across seven counties with clinics in Yakima, Sunnyside, Walla Walla, Ellensburg, Pasco, and Cle Elum. The organization employs about 700 professionals and serves more than 20,000 individuals annually, offering integrated healthcare, mental health services, and community education. What Patients Say
Overall sentiment across review platforms: mixed
- Birdeye (Google): 2.5/5 (81)
- Rehab.com (Two Rivers Landing): 2.6/5 (70)
- Rehab.com (Pathways): 3/5 (7)
- Recovery.com (Detox/Crisis Triage): 1.8/5 (12)
Patients praise
- Some patients report positive experiences with specific therapists and counselors
- Gratitude for long-term support and guidance received from certain staff members
- Appreciation for the 'go at your own pace' environment in specific programs
Common complaints
- Concerns regarding staff rudeness and lack of compassion/empathy
- Allegations of medication being forced or used to 'numb' patients rather than provide therapy
- Frustration with administrative processes, including lost paperwork and poor communication
- Criticism of discharge procedures and lack of aftercare coordination
- Claims that the facility prioritizes financial gains over patient welfare
